Conversations With Students
ACCESS is created to show a student's progression as a student learning English. When discussing ACCESS with your students (or other stakeholders), please do not frame your conversation around "passing". Passing would indicate failure if a specific score was not attained. Please be mindful and do not use verbiage such as "pass" when discussing ACCESS with your students, teachers, and families. Please do talk about the fact that ACCESS provides a student's English proficiency level, and indicates their growth as an English Learner.
Redesignation
Districts have not yet received cut scores for redesignation for FEP Y1 monitoring from CDE. The lack of cut scores is a result of the recent WIDA Standard Setting Process, and we will have official cut scores from CDE after May 24, 2017.
As a general rule, this means that we cannot yet determine eligibility for redesignation for some students because we do not know the score required for Fluent English Proficient. While you may share ACCESS scores with your students and families, please do not correlate ACCESS scores with Redesignation at this time.
You will notice that all redesignation forms have been removed from the District ELD google site. Once guidance has been received, forms will be updated and uploaded for your use.
We will have more information at the ELD Think Tank, and you will receive further instructions when we release the 2017 End of Year Instructions.
**A few of you have referred to the CDE CLD Guidebook. This was revised in October of 2016, and CDE was not aware of the need for a change in cut scores. The CLD Guidebook is currently being updated to reflect updated cut scores, and the revision is NOT YET COMPLETE.
ACCESS Growth
You may be asking, "What would my student's have earned last year on ACCESS?" WIDA has released the Score Lookup Calculator. Once logged in, the Score Lookup Calculator will translate your student's scores, and it will inform you of their actual growth from 2016 ACCESS TO 2017 ACCESS. This calculator will not be used by CDE, and it is intended only for your instructional purposes.
